PRISA has an unequivocal commitment to sustainable development and the United Nations 2030 Agenda. PRISA's 2022-2025 Sustainability Master Plan (SMP) sets out seven priority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) for its activity and one transversal SDG. Throughout 2022, the Group has developed multiple initiatives specifically aimed at contributing to these objectives. PRISA's contribution to the SDGs This is undoubtedly one of the most significant SDGs to which PRISA decisively contributes via Santillana. Santillana is committed to offering life opportunities through education, to leading the transformation and the improvement of education centers in Latin America, and to offering students, teachers and schools a quality education that is both inclusive and equal . Santillana stands as a staunch ally of schools in meeting the challenge of educating in sustainable development. To this end, it offers teacher training, with specific courses on ESG and with contents that reflect the diversity of society and that stimulate reflection around the enormous global challenges (social and environmental) raised by the 2030 Agenda. One example from 2022 is the online mini-training course on SDGs that was offered to the 6,152 teachers registered on the Training Paths platform. One of the SMP's key objectives is precisely to incorporate sustainable development into 100% of Santillana's new educational projects by 2025 . By the end of 2023, 45%% of new educational initiatives should have content on sustainability and the SDGs for students and teachers. Projects such as Compartir’s Asombro , for preschool and primary school pupils in Mexico , include learning modules inspired by the SDGs. In Colombia, Activamente Digital, Chrysalis and Set 21 Robótica get students of different educational levels involved in creating solutions to the issues and challenges posed by the different SDGs.  Santillana offers more than 2,000 books for use in working on the SDGs via reading comprehension. Loqueleo Digital includes activities to engage students with the 2030 Agenda in a practical way.  The #VoyaSer program in Peru and Guatemala helps indigenous girls in vulnerable situations to complete secondary education and train in digital and social skills that will help them in their personal and professional development. This initiative, developed in partnership with the Entreculturas Foundation and the Fe y Alegría association, was a finalist in the Good Practices category at the Global Sustainability Week Awards in Spain.  The Santillana Foundation also carries out initiatives to promote dialogue and reflection on achieving more equal, diverse and inclusive education. In 2022 alone, the activities and publications in Brazil reached close to 200,000 people . In Argentina , the Foundation has continued to contribute to the debate on education – with publications such as 50 teachers who are transforming Latin America – and to highlight good practices with the VIVALectura Award PRISA Media has promoted SDG4 through forums such as EL PAÍS with your future , an educational event focused on the world of work and professional development that offers young people – in their last year of secondary school and vocational training school – careers guidance. A total of 23 experts in artificial intelligence (AI), robotics, blockchain and cybersecurity explained their work to 975 students . The UAM-EL PAÍS School of Journalism , created in 1986, belongs to a nonprofit foundation run jointly by the Autonomous University of Madrid and EL PAÍS. Its main activity is the master’s degree in journalism , which had 69 students in 2022. In Colombia, W Radio took part once again last year in the Vamos Pa’lante (Let’s Get Ahead) campaign, run by Los Andes University and five other universities in the country, to grant scholarships to support undergraduate students at risk of dropping out from their studies for financial reasons. In 2022, grants were given to 1,128 students .
